CO - CUBA, NA-015
Members of the "Cuban Amateur Radio Federation" (CO2FRC) are going to
join the multi/multi class of the upcoming Volta Contest (May 8/9).
The team includes Gustavo,CO2NO, Lazaro,CO2WL, Jesus,CO2IZ, and
Winston,CO2WF. Another chance to work Cuba (NA-015) in digital modes
is on odd days in May. Gustavo,CO2NO, will be active in PSK31 and JT65A
from 1200-0000 UTC on 14070 kHz and from 0000-0300 UTC on 7038-7040 kHz
QSLs for CO2NO only direct via HA3JB: Gabor Kutasi, H-8601 Siofok,
PO Box 243, Hungary. Gabor asks everyone to write his e-mail address
on the QSL card so he can confirm the arrival of the QSLs via e-mail.

KH5 - JARVIS ISLAND, OC-081
Several sources have reported that Radio Expeditions Inc, the organizer
of the record-breaking VP6DX DXpedition to Ducie Island in 2008, is
planning a DXpedition to Jarvis Island (OC-081) in November 2010.
Depending on weather and sea conditions the approximate dates for this
operation are between Nov 17 and Dec 1. Dates were chosen to maximize
propagation openings on both the lower bands (160m-80m) and the high
bands (12m-10m) to Europe, where demand for KH5 is extremely high. The
planning for this project began over one year ago and applications for
the required permits to land on the island have been submitted to the
US Fish & Wildlife Service. However, the final approval has not yet
been received. The DXpedition team plans to have 24-25 operators to man
12 stations on 160m-6m using CW, SSB and RTTY (no 60m operations are
planned). Entering the CQWW CW Contest is also included in their plans.
Sea transportation will be provided by the "MV Braveheart" - which
supported also other DXpeditions before. We will keep you informed
about this DXpedition.

ZS8 - MARION ISLAND, AF-021
"The DX Magazine" lists Marion Island (AF-021) on rank 3 of the most
wanted DXCC entities worldwide. The new team of scientists on the
island includes Pierre,ZS1HF. On Marion Island his job will be the
resident radio and electronics technician for HF, VHF, the WX station,
the Hydrogen generator, IT LAN, the satellite system and all the other
smaller systems. Starting around May 5 he will show up as ZS8M for one
year. He arrived on the island on Apr 15 but was very busy with other
important things. Due to the heavy storms and to protect the local
birds he will use only dipoles. Since he is allowed only 100 kg private
luggage Pierre took only a small amplifier to the island. During his
little spare time Pierre will be active mostly in SSB but also in RTTY
on 160m-2m - he does not work in CW. Please listen for him especially
on 14240 kHz. Unfortunately the QSL cards can be sent only direct to:
Pierre D. Tromp, PO Box 1481, Worcester 6850, Republic South Africa.
